Towards the Haptiverse: An Online System for Sharing Haptic Content

Research into haptic technology has accelerated over the past decade, producing more devices and content than ever before. However, due to the technology's innate diversity, existing haptic collections are limited to a specific physical technology or interaction modality. Hapticians, who are designers, researchers, or developers of haptic experiences, are left with a fragmented ecosystem of resources, making it difficult to build upon each others' work. To remedy this, we are actively developing the Haptiverse, an online system for sharing haptic experiences and platforms. Our contribution is the creation of a system architecture that can assist hapticians to find, use, and share existing haptic content.
